Senior Living in Centerville, Ohio

Senior living communities in Centerville, Ohio offer a range of options tailored to the diverse needs and preferences of older adults. From independent living to continuing care retirement communities, seniors can find a suitable living arrangement that promotes independence and well-being. Assisted living communities in Centerville provide support with daily tasks, while luxury senior living communities offer upscale amenities for those seeking a more refined lifestyle.

Common amenities in senior living communities include restaurant-style dining, fitness centers, and scheduled transportation for outings and appointments. Additionally, residents can enjoy activities such as arts and crafts, educational classes, and social events to stay engaged and connected with peers.

Accommodations in senior living communities vary, ranging from cozy studio apartments to spacious two-bedroom suites. Some communities offer cottages or villas for those who prefer a standalone living arrangement. Each accommodation is designed with seniors' comfort and convenience in mind, featuring modern amenities and safety features.

Centerville, Ohio, is surrounded by cities like Dayton, Kettering, and Beavercreek, where seniors can also find senior living options. Montgomery County, where Centerville is located, offers diverse senior housing complexes and communities to meet the growing demand for senior care in the area.

Pros of senior living in Centerville include access to nearby healthcare facilities like Miami Valley Hospital and Kettering Health Network, ensuring residents receive prompt medical attention when needed. Additionally, Ohio's relatively low property taxes and income taxes can be advantageous for retirees looking to manage their expenses. However, some cons may include the cost of senior living, which can vary depending on the level of care and amenities provided, and the potential for inclement weather during winter months, which may affect outdoor activities and mobility for seniors. Senior living in Centerville offers a supportive and enriching environment for older adults to thrive in their golden years.

Frequently Asked Questions About Senior Living in Centerville, OH

What are senior living communities?

Senior living communities are residential settings designed to accommodate older adults. These communities provide various levels of care and services, ranging from independent living to assisted living and memory care.

What types of senior living options are available in CENTERVILLE?

Senior living options in Centerville include independent living, where residents have their own apartments; assisted living, which offers assistance with daily activities; memory care, for individuals with dementia; and nursing homes, providing round-the-clock medical care.

How can I determine the right senior living community in Centerville?

Consider your needs, preferences, and budget. Visit senior communities to assess the environment, services, and activities. Discuss your options with family, friends, and healthcare professionals for guidance.

What amenities are commonly offered in Centerville senior living communities?

Senior living communities in Centerville often provide amenities like dining options, fitness centers, recreational activities, transportation services, housekeeping, and social opportunities to enhance residents' quality of life.

How does independent living in Centerville differ from assisted living?

Independent living is for self-sufficient seniors who want an active lifestyle, while Centerville assisted living caters to those who require help with activities of daily living, such as bathing, dressing, and medication management.

Are there social activities for residents in senior living communities in Centerville?

Senior living communities often offer a variety of social activities, including group outings, fitness classes, arts and crafts, book clubs, and social events to foster a sense of community and engagement among residents.

Can I bring my own furniture to a senior living apartment in Centerville?

In many Centerville senior living communities, you're encouraged to bring your own furniture to personalize your living space and create a comfortable environment. However, it's recommended to check with the community's guidelines and restrictions regarding furniture size, safety, and compatibility.

Is transportation assistance available for residents?

Yes, senior living communities in Centerville often offer transportation services for residents. These services may include scheduled trips to medical appointments, shopping centers, cultural events, and other destinations to help residents maintain their independence and stay connected.

Are pets allowed in Centerville senior living facilities?

Some senior living facilities in Centerville may be pet-friendly and allow residents to bring their beloved pets. However, pet policies can vary, so it's important to inquire about specific pet-related rules, size restrictions, and any associated fees before moving in with a pet.

How can I cover the costs of Centerville senior living?

Funding senior living can be covered through various means, including personal savings, pensions, Social Security benefits, retirement accounts, long-term care insurance, and government assistance programs like Medicaid. It's recommended to discuss financial planning with a financial advisor to determine the best approach for your situation.

What should I consider before moving to a senior living community in Centerville?

Before moving to a senior living community in Centerville, consider factors such as location, services offered, cost, level of care provided, community atmosphere, and proximity to family and friends. Visit the community, talk to current residents, and assess how well it aligns with your needs and preferences.
